Keys damaged or lost
It can be a stressful experience when you lose your Toyota keys or when the key fob breaks down. If you are looking for an alternative to your traditional metal key or a more advanced remote key fob, we'll provide the right solution for you.
Toyota provides some of the most technologically advanced car keys available on the market. These include transponder chips which communicate with the vehicle to prevent unauthorized starting and make it impossible to start the engine if the wrong key is used. These chips also allow you to lock and unlock your car remotely and start it. This extra security comes with the cost. Replacing a damaged or lost Toyota key can cost hundreds of dollars.
You can determine if your Toyota key is equipped with a transponder chip by examining the blade of the key. If there is a tiny dot or dimple on one side, or if the key has an 'H' or 'G' marking it is equipped with a transponder. The key will not be marked or have a big bump at the top if it's not marked.
Traditional metal keys are simple to replace and generally cost less than $50. The cost of key fobs that have a transponder chip is greater, since they need to be programmed to work with the vehicle's system to immobilize it. The equipment to accomplish this can be found at dealerships and can cost anywhere from $150 to $250. In addition the key has to be cut and laser-programmed.

Key Fob Battery Replacement
Change the battery on your key fob isn't as hard or time-consuming as it appear. You can purchase replacement batteries from any big-box retailer or hardware stores. You can also order them on the internet. A new battery is not only cheap, but it can also restore the proper function of your key fob.
The first step is to take off the key from the metal. There's typically a small metal button located right above the key portion of the fob. To remove the key, press this button. Then, remove the fob. This can be done by pressing the small hole on the fob that looks like a keyhole or by inserting the flat tool into the hole with the smallest. Once you have the fob divided into two pieces - a front and a back, sliding a tool into the notch or small opening can allow you to access the battery compartment.
Take a look at the battery. It is likely to be silver and shaped in a circle. It will have a marking on it that identifies the type of battery you need to replace it.
